In a community effort, QVC is joining leaders in the fashion industry to support the Council of Fashion Designers of America with its “Fashion for Haiti” initiative. QVC will sell “Fashion for Haiti” T-shirts on-air, on QVC.com and at its shows that will benefit the Clinton Bush Haiti Fund, supporting immediate, high-impact relief and long-term recovery efforts for the victims of the earthquakes.

The Yves Saint Laurent Spring/Summer 2010 Manifesto will make an exclusive debut in the streets of New York on Tuesday, February 16, 2010, followed by a worldwide release on Saturday, February 20 in the streets of Paris, London, Milan, Tokyo, Hong Kong and, for the first time, Berlin. After last season’s powerful introduction of the Manifesto to the city of Seoul, Korea, it was decided that each successive season would bring a new destination for the Manifesto project, ensuring that in keeping with its ethic, the Manifesto’s message travels far and wide.

This Manifesto – the sixth edition, was photographed by Inez van Lamsweerde and Vinoodh Matadin under the creative direction of Stefano Pilati, and features Natalia Vodianova in the Yves Saint Laurent Spring/Summer 2010 collection. In a spirited gesture of generosity and democracy, like past seasons about half a million copies of the Manifesto will be distributed globally and to the first 2,000 passerby in each city with a custom cotton tote bag designed by Pilati. Mary J. Blige x Catherine Malandrino T shirt Collection

Catherine Malandrino has teamed up with her friend Mary J. Blige to cobrand a T-shirt collection called FFAWN + Catherine Malandrino launching in stores next week. FFAWN, Foundation for the Achievement of Women Now, is the charity MJB started in 2008. According to WWD, the collection features tunics with hand-painted messages such as “I’m Free” and “I’m Power.” The off-the-shoulder tops pictured on them retails starting for $39, will also be sold in the designer’s freestanding stores, and a percentage of all sales will benefit FFAWN. Additional styles will play up an abstract illustration of a phoenix and the FFAWN logo. If you want to meet them both, they will be greeting shoppers at Bloomingdale’s new 350-square-foot Catherine Malandrino concept shop in Manhattan on February 17th.

“As a designer, I feel I have a role to play. What I want is to free women,” Malandrino said. “Femininity is a strength and not a weakness.”

“Catherine has been a dear friend of mine for years and, after she learned about FFAWN and our mission, she offered to create a T-shirt collection that would celebrate being women, being strong and being free. These are not your average T-shirts,” she said.
